Intuitive 5D Automated Reproducible Technology
5D NT supports intuitive confirmation of the fetal mid-sagittal view, which is first automatically detected and appropriately zoomed from volume data. Then, the fetal nuchal translucency thickness can be measured with simple and efficient semi-automatic operation, reducing operator dependency.
5D LB allows for easy, automatic detection and measurement of fetal long bones from volume data, with intuitive visualization of the fetal structures. Diagnosis of fetal malformation becomes efficient as 5D LB improves measurement accuracy while reducing exam time.
With 5D Stereo Cine, life-like 3D images can be displayed on Samsung 3D Smart TVs for parents-to-be, families, and friends to view more realistic images of the fetus at home.

TMAD (Tissue Motion Annulus Displacement)
A key feature of the EKO 7 is Tissue Motion Annular Displacement (TMAD), which uses 2D speckle tracking technology. It is a highly convenient and simple way to perform mitral annular displacement from any angle, thus providing greater clarity in cases of limited accessibility and visibility. TMAD consistently delivers rapid, robust and accurate estimates of Ejection Fraction (EF) to provide a more complete overview of the area being diagnosed.
4 way motorized TEE
The EKO 7 includes a 4-way motorised Transesophageal Echocardiogram (TEE) feature which generates a set of images within a cone from the same position in the esophagus. Its motorised tip deflection control is composed of two wheels which allow for greater mobility and more precise positioning of the transducer. The direction of the tip is easily steered up, down, to the right and left, creating a wide field of view. Designed for one-hand operation, this technology offers user convenience and flexibility.
